Output 860f6417714af2c665db5d171c99f5ddadee2a117566782c2f07eec5494edde1:19

value
386513000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fdd96d669180f5e62a5128962bc01aa687fb879 OP_EQUAL
address
MUJrNVkcBu8byuEziaTf7sCfdtSkqjEsW2
transaction
860f6417714af2c665db5d171c99f5ddadee2a117566782c2f07eec5494edde1
spent
true